Power listed is conducted.

Operations in the band 5.15-5.25GHz are restricted to indoor use only.

Device contains 20/40/80MHz Bandwidth.

Device is DFS client without radar detector capability.

For body worn operation, this phone has been tested and meets the FCC RF exposure guidelines when used with an accessory that contains no metal and that positions the handset at a minimum of 1 cm from the users body. End-users must be informed of the body-worn operating requirements for satisfying RF exposure compliance.

The highest reported SAR values for head, body-worn accessory, and simultaneous transmission use conditions are <0.10 W/kg, <0.10 W/kg, and 1.18 W/kg, respectively.


CC: This device is certified pursuant to two different Part 15 rules sections.
HX: This mode of operation has the means to permit held to the ear telephone calls but has not been tested for hearing aid compatibility. The device supports other modes which have been found to be compliant with the HAC rules.
ND: This UNII device complies with the Transmit Power Control (TPC) and Dynamic Frequency Selection (DFS) requirements in Section 15.407(h).
